Ordinals
beta
Sat 942130608896330
decimal
188426.608896330
degree
0°188426′938″608896330‴
percentile
44.863362377746384%
name
hefpksuwaot
cycle
0
epoch
0
period
93
block
188426
offset
608896330
timestamp
2012-07-10 12:36:52 UTC
rarity
common
prev
next